Сколько всего строк в Excel VBA

Если вы работаете с большими объемами данных в Excel и хотите узнать количество строк в своей таблице, то эта статья для вас. Задача посчитать количество строк может быть очень полезной при анализе данных или создании отчетов. Но как можно быстро и эффективно выполнить эту задачу с помощью VBA?

VBA (Visual Basic for Applications) — это язык программирования, который позволяет автоматизировать задачи в Excel. С помощью VBA вы можете создавать макросы, которые будут выполнять определенные действия в таблицах Excel. В нашем случае, мы будем использовать VBA для подсчета количества строк в таблице.

Один из самых простых способов подсчета строк в Excel с помощью VBA — это использование свойства «Rows». Свойство «Rows» возвращает коллекцию всех строк в таблице. Мы можем использовать метод «Count» для подсчета количества строк в этой коллекции.

Например, если у вас есть таблица с данными, вы можете написать следующий код на VBA:

Sub CountRows()

    Dim rowCount As Integer

    rowCount = ActiveSheet.Rows.Count

    MsgBox «Количество строк в таблице: » & rowCount

End Sub

Таким образом, использование VBA позволяет легко и быстро узнать количество строк в таблице Excel. Вы можете использовать эту информацию для своих аналитических или отчетных задач.

Что такое Excel VBA

Excel VBA предоставляет широкий набор инструментов и функций, позволяя пользователям создавать пользовательские формы, добавлять кнопки и события, создавать сложные калькуляторы, отчеты, диаграммы и графики. Он также позволяет выполнять операции с данными, такие как фильтрация, сортировка, поиск и обработка больших объемов информации.

Основные преимущества Excel VBA заключаются в его гибкости и адаптируемости к индивидуальным потребностям пользователя. С помощью VBA можно автоматизировать повторяющиеся задачи, что значительно экономит время и упрощает выполнение сложных операций, а также позволяет пользователю извлекать максимальную пользу из Excel, используя все его возможности и функции.

Читайте также:  Смысл слова быть связанным

Excel VBA также обладает обширной документацией, богатым сообществом пользователей и доступом к онлайн ресурсам, что делает его изучение и использование доступными для всех, независимо от уровня опыта в программировании. Благодаря своей популярности и универсальности, Excel VBA является незаменимым инструментом для тех, кто работает с данными в Excel и желает повысить свою продуктивность и эффективность работы.

Почему использовать Excel VBA

В работе с Excel часто возникает необходимость автоматизировать выполнение рутинных задач. Именно в таких случаях на помощь приходит Excel VBA (Visual Basic for Applications), интегрированная среда разработки, позволяющая создавать макросы и программы для автоматизации процессов.

VBA обладает множеством преимуществ, которые делают его незаменимым инструментом для работы с Excel. Во-первых, благодаря возможности создания макросов, VBA позволяет ускорить выполнение действий в Excel. Вместо того чтобы выполнять однотипные операции вручную, можно записать макрос, который будет выполнять эти операции автоматически. Это позволяет сократить время работы над проектом и снизить вероятность ошибок.

Во-вторых, использование VBA позволяет создавать сложные программы на базе Excel. VBA позволяет взаимодействовать с другими приложениями Microsoft Office, а также с внешними источниками данных. Это дает возможность создавать интегрированные решения, автоматизируя работу не только с Excel, но и с другими приложениями, такими как Word, PowerPoint, Outlook и др.

В-третьих, VBA обладает мощным набором инструментов для работы с данными. Встроенные объекты и методы VBA позволяют выполнять операции с ячейками, столбцами и строками в Excel, а также проводить анализ данных, фильтровать их, сортировать и многое другое. Это делает VBA идеальным инструментом для работы с большими объемами информации.

  • Быстрая и эффективная автоматизация процессов в Excel.
  • Возможность создания сложных программ на базе Excel.
  • Мощные возможности для работы с данными.
Читайте также:  Rdweb windows 2012 r2

Основы Excel VBA

Основная структура программы VBA состоит из модулей, в которых содержатся процедуры и функции. Процедуры выполняют определенные действия, а функции возвращают значения. Каждая процедура и функция в VBA начинается с ключевого слова «Sub» или «Function», за которым следует имя процедуры или функции. Код VBA выполняется поочередно, от верхней строки к нижней.

Начинающие пользователи Excel VBA могут использовать запись макросов для создания своего кода. Запись макросов позволяет записать серию действий, которые затем можно повторить с помощью созданного макроса. Записанный макрос может быть отредактирован в VBA редакторе, где можно внести изменения и настроить его поведение.

Excel VBA предоставляет множество встроенных функций и методов для работы с данными и объектами в Excel. Например, можно использовать методы для выбора ячеек и диапазонов, чтения и записи данных, форматирования ячеек, создания графиков и многое другое. Кроме того, VBA также поддерживает работу с внешними данными, включая базы данных и другие файлы.

  • Excel VBA позволяет автоматизировать рутинные задачи и упростить работу с данными в Excel.
  • С его помощью можно создавать пользовательские макросы и функции для настройки Excel под свои потребности.
  • VBA обладает большим набором встроенных функций и методов, что значительно расширяет возможности Excel.
  • Начинающие пользователи могут использовать запись макросов для создания кода и его дальнейшего редактирования.
  • Excel VBA поддерживает работу с различными типами данных и возможность работы с внешними источниками данных.

В целом, Excel VBA является мощным инструментом для работы с данными в Excel. Learning VBA позволяет не только автоматизировать рутинные задачи, но и создавать настраиваемые решения для улучшения продуктивности и эффективности работы в Excel.

Определение количества строк в Excel VBA

Один из простых способов определения количества строк в Excel VBA — использование свойства «Rows.Count». Это свойство позволяет получить общее количество строк в таблице. Например, следующий код позволяет нам определить количество строк в активном листе:

Dim rowCount As Long
rowCount = ActiveSheet.Rows.Count

Еще один способ определения количества строк — использование специального объекта «Range», который представляет собой диапазон ячеек в таблице. Мы можем использовать метод «Rows.Count» для этого объекта, чтобы получить количество строк. Вот пример кода:

Dim rangeObj As Range
Dim rowCount As Long
Set rangeObj = ActiveSheet.UsedRange
rowCount = rangeObj.Rows.Count

В данном примере мы сначала задаем объект «Range» как «UsedRange» активного листа, что позволяет нам получить диапазон ячеек с данными. Затем мы используем метод «Rows.Count» для объекта «rangeObj» и записываем результат в переменную «rowCount», чтобы получить количество строк.

Читайте также:  Изменение цвета ячейки строки в Excel - практическое руководство

Таким образом, с помощью этих методов исследования Excel VBA мы можем определить количество строк в таблице и использовать эту информацию для управления данными и выполнения различных задач.

В данной статье были представлены примеры кода на Excel VBA, позволяющие определить количество строк в таблице. Рассмотрены различные подходы, включая использование функций и методов для работы с объектами. Приведенные примеры обеспечивают эффективное и точное определение количества строк, в зависимости от требуемого функционала.

Важно отметить, что выбор наиболее подходящего кода зависит от конкретных задач и условий работы с таблицей. Приведенные примеры представляют лишь основу для разработки индивидуального решения.

Использование кода для определения количества строк в Excel VBA позволяет автоматизировать процесс работы с таблицами, обеспечивает точность и удобство анализа данных. Знание таких методов и функций поможет повысить эффективность работы с таблицами в Excel и улучшить процесс принятия решений на основе данных.

Оцените статью